Did something similar once; back in 2004 we were travelling to Maidstone when we discovered upon leaving Victoria, that our thermos flask, containing the hot water to warm up the baby milk bottle with had broken - and little one was starting to stir with a feed due!

Texted a friend who works for South Eastern with what had happened and which train we were on.

Three stops later, a member of station staff handed over to us a flask full of hot water, just in time to avert some loud squalling from a hungry baby.:)

We returned the flask by handing it in, as arranged, at Maidstone East to be sent back on the next train.
